Web 2.0
Clearly, somehow you have found a way to my lens. Great work! However, depending on if you are a developer, or came here by fluke, you may be wondering; What exactly is Web2.0?
Well, it isn't a new version of the internet, contrary to what the name suggests. No. Instead, it is the latest trend in webdesign that encourages creativity, collaboration, and information sharing among the users.
Web2.0 isn't only a trend. It is also a way of styling your website. Most Web2.0 sites use shiny colors, have badges, and generally look fun. The most notable feature being Simplicity.
Some examples of Web2.0 websites are:
-Youtube
-Blogspot (And most likely your blog,)
-Wikipedia
and many, many more. Those are just ones that you probably recognize, webdesigner or not.
The definition of Web2.0 varies from person to person. To me, it is both a design style, and a form of interactivity for your users. For others, it just means interactivity. For some, it's just a design style.

Stripe Generator
Stripe Generator is a tool that will aid you in making stripes for your website. It consists of but a few sliders, that control the colors, size, and other options of your stripes.
I commonly use this tool to design backgrounds for my web2.0 pages. Striped Backgrounds are a notable characteristic of many websites, and they look amazing.
Stripe Designer
Same basic concept as Stripe Generator, but executed differently. This tool by Alex Le allows you to make stripes, but in a different way. You are given a canvas with pixels, and you have to make the stripes. It even has images you can use as a background behind the stripes!
Of course, it also has pre-designed stripes that you can choose from, and edit if you wish, making this both a helpful tool, and a helpful collection for webdesign, even though it was originally designed for Photoshop.

Tabs Generator
Let's face it-- Web 2.0 Navigation is always better with tabs. Well, almost always, at least. However, tabs are so much harder to make than a normal link list menu, or a box menu.
Fear not, Alex 'Pit' La Rosa and Fabio Fidanza (The creators of Stripe Generator,) have come to the rescue, with this fantastic tool. Allowing you to change the height, width, border size, colors, gradients, orientations, and much more, you can easily make tabs in a matter of seconds using Tabs Generator.
Web 2.0 Badges
Perhaps the most used Web 2.0 trends is badges. They can announce the beta status of your web page, show off your latest deal, or display any other kind of important text. Not only that, they are stylish, and almost expected to show up on any Web 2.0 website.
This tool lets you do all that. You start by selecting a base image, then you choose the text, the color, and the angle. Good job! You're done.

Loader Generator
Web 2.0 often times uses Ajax, Flash, or other scripting languages that require loading. Of course, if it is just a blank page until it loads, some of your potential customers, or your viewers, could disappear. Now, with Flash, you can easily make a loading screen. But what about Ajax? You can, but it is a lot easier just to use an image. And, often times it looks nicer.
If you believe that as well, then Loader Generator is for you. You can pick your choice of 132 base images (at the time of this writing,) then you can pick the background and foreground color, along with a size. And don't worry for those of you with image backgrounds, or gradients-- There is a transparency option.
BGPatterns
BGPatterns is a unique concept, which can really become famous quite quick. What you do is pick some colors, an optional texture, choose a rotation, and pick an image, then it makes a tilable image, to be used as the background of a website.
This tool also has what many of the others don't: An option to preview it in it's natural environment. (As the background of a page.)
